It's already happening with PC Games (like 50% are sold digital), it will happen to consoles in next generation, and with all kind of audiovisual products in the next few years.
The point is that there is demand for this. Every digital service is a success (Steam being the biggest).
And it's the logical future. No physical copies mean no space used in our everyday smaller houses. Means those products are available for you worldwide, no matter where you go, if there's an Internet connection then you don't have to carry them. Means (or should mean) cheaper prices, due to costs reduction. Means less resources used in manufacture, less fuel used in distribution, etc... Means more visibility for small/indie companies (already happening with games). Means more profit per unit for companies (due to direct distribution and costs reduction).
Everybody wins. It's just good business.
Security issues are not bigger than the ones you have with any Internet service. People worldwide is not afraid about using any of them and I don't think they will be in the future. IMO the only letdown is the inclusion of invasive DRMs in this products (but that's already happening with physical ones). And it would require better Internet connections, but that's being fixed every year. In my nearest town you have 10MBs Internet + Cable TV for 80$ a month. That means 36GB downloaded in one hour.
At the end everything is just about nostalgia and feelings. A plastic case with a physical plastic disc doesn't have any real advantages.
Nowadays quality in digital movies is not the same, totally agree, but it will be. It's just a matter of time.
